The Hextree Faultier is a low-cost suite including hardware for performing voltage fault-injection attacks, and is the companion hardware for the Hextree fault-injection courses.

It contains an N-Channel MOSFET for crowbar glitching, as well as a 2-channel analogue switch for dipping voltage or re-powering targets, and can trigger external devices such as the NewAE ChipSHOUTER. It also runs a basic SWD debug probe, allowing you to dump your glitched chips and to determine glitching success when re-enabling debugging features such as when performing the nRF52 APPROTECT bypass or the STM32 RDP2-to-1 downgrade.
It also allows for basic voltage measurements, for example to time the glitch of an nRF52. Faultier can be controlled using the "faultier" Python package.
